how does this shortblock sound?
385 LT1 short block built by Kowalsky machine out of Lynchburg Va (www.kowalskymachine.com)
Scat forged 4340 crank 3.75 stroke
Eagle 5.7" H beams
JE forged pistons (12.5:1 w/64CC heads) 4.040"
SpeedPro hell fire rings
Program billet 4 bolt mains with ARP main studs
all coated bearings (std size)
Cloyes Hex-a-just double roller
Melling HVLP oil pump with welded on pickup for Milidon pan
machine work
4.040 bore and hone
line honed
true 4 bolt block
rings gapped for nitrous
0 decked
lifter valley holes tapped and filled with pipe plugs and vent tubes to prevent windage
front and rear drain plugs screened
Milidon 7qt oil pan
SFI damper (pro products)
COMP cams custom grind solid roller cam installed and degreed in
24X*/25X* 63X"/64X" ( the lift is with a 1.65 intake and 1.75 exhaust rocker)
motor was almost the same before the rebuild and made 562HP and 527TQ at 6700 with 11.5:1 compression on motor on the engine dyno but is built for up to a 300 shot
i think i will be going with either AI or LE heads

Sounds fine except for the chinese junk pro products damper - ditch that for an ATI. Also I would be building some trick flow heads if you're spending that much money on the bottom end. Will flow more when ported, and thicker deck for nitrous use.
You also do not want a high volume pump, especially with a solid roller cam - just extra parasitic loss and excess oil in the top end. Get a standard pump with the high pressure spring.
